ISamlService - интерфейс

Сервис, предоставляющий методы для SSO-авторизации (Single Sign On) по протоколу SAML. Может использоваться для интеграции с доменом Active Directory Foundation Services. Используется в web-клиенте TESSA.

Definition

Пространство имён: Tessa.Web.Client.Services
Сборка: Tessa.Web.Client (в Tessa.Web.Client.dll) Версия: 4.0.4
C#
public interface ISamlService

Методы

AssertionConsumerServiceAsync Метод, вызываемый при входе в систему после подтверждения авторизации SAML. Возвращает результат входа, обычно это редирект на определённую страницу.
GetMetadataAsync Запрос, возвращающий метаинформацию SAML.
LoggedOutAsync Удаляет привязку SAML, производит запись в cookies о факте закрытия и редирект на основную страницу. Метод вызывается после закрытия сессии.
LoginAsync Окно входа в систему для использования совместно с SAML-авторизацией.
LogoutAsync Выход из системы при авторизации SAML.
SingleLogoutAsync Осуществляет выход из системы в SAML, запрошенный пользователем для удаления информации по входу во всех SSO-приложениях, в т.ч. в системе TESSA.

См. также